hacked the postinst script to set the permission I wanted, so bind9
installs properly. Probably going to be broken with the next upgrade
to that package. I

diff --git a/debian/bind9.postinst b/debian/bind9.postinst
index 98c4cd3..68e7f3b 100644
--- a/debian/bind9.postinst
+++ b/debian/bind9.postinst
@@ -116,7 +116,7 @@ if [ "$1" = configure ]; then

     uid=$(ls -ln /etc/bind/rndc.key | awk '{print $3}')
     if [ "$uid" = "0" ]; then
-       [ -n "$localconf" ] || chown bind /etc/bind/rndc.key
+       [ -n "$localconf" ] || chown root:bind /etc/bind/rndc.key
        chgrp bind /etc/bind
        chmod g+s /etc/bind
        chgrp bind /etc/bind/rndc.key /var/run/bind/run /var/cache/bind


Although perhaps it should be something like
+       [ -n "$localconf" ] || chown $(getent passwd $uid | cut -d ':'
-f 1):bind /etc/bind/rndc.key

which just looks like a mess.
